flow_keys: Record IP layer protocol in skb_flow_dissect()

skb_flow_dissect() dissects only transport header type in ip_proto. It dose not
give any information about IPv4 or IPv6.

This patch adds new member, n_proto, to struct flow_keys. Which records the
IP layer type. i.e IPv4 or IPv6.

This can be used in netdev->ndo_rx_flow_steer driver function to dissect flow.

Adding new member to flow_keys increases the struct size by around 4 bytes.
This causes BUILD_BUG_ON(sizeof(qcb->data) < sz); to fail in
qdisc_cb_private_validate()

So increase data size by 4
